115 Moo 7, Tambol Bangkao Cha Am, Cha Am, Thailand
Alila Cha Am Photos
Alila Cha Am Map
115 Moo 7, Tambol Bangkao Cha Am, Cha Am, Thailand
Searching for availability
Hotel Information
This 4 star hotel is located on the coastline of Cha Am. The Hotel has a coffee shop, an outdoor swimming pool and a fitness centre/gym. All 79 rooms are equipped with minibar, safe and air conditioning.